Condividi tramite


KSAUDIO_COPY_PROTECTION struttura (ksmedia.h)

La struttura KSAUDIO_COPY_PROTECTION specifica lo stato di protezione della copia di un flusso audio.

Sintassi

typedef struct {
  BOOL fCopyrighted;
  BOOL fOriginal;
} KSAUDIO_COPY_PROTECTION, *PKSAUDIO_COPY_PROTECTION;

Members

fCopyrighted

Indica se il flusso è protetto da copyright. Se TRUE, il flusso è protetto da copyright. Se FALSE, il flusso non è protetto da copyright e non è soggetto alla protezione della copia.

fOriginal

Indica se il flusso è una copia originale di prima generazione di un flusso o di una copia di seconda generazione dell'originale. Se TRUE, il flusso è originale. Se FALSE, è una copia di seconda generazione.

Commenti

La proprietà KSPROPERTY_AUDIO_COPY_PROTECTION usa questa struttura per segnalare se un flusso è protetto da copyright e anche se il flusso è un flusso originale o una copia del flusso originale.

Un dispositivo audio che supporta la protezione della copia può usare informazioni di copyright e copia di generazione su un flusso per impedire la copia illimitata di contenuti audio proprietari. Ad esempio, il sistema di gestione della copia seriale definisce un livello di protezione della copia che consente la copia di una copia originale e di prima generazione di un flusso, ma impedisce la copia di copie di seconda generazione del flusso.

La proprietà KSPROPERTY_AUDIO_COPY_PROTECTION è separata da e non correlata all'implementazione di Digital Rights Management (DRM) e al percorso audio sicuro (SAP) per Windows Media.

Requisiti

Requisito Valore
Intestazione ksmedia.h (includere Ksmedia.h)

Vedi anche

KSPROPERTY_AUDIO_COPY_PROTECTION